The WakaTime plugin for Kakoune gives you real-time metrics per project, file, branch, commit, feature, operating system, language, etc.

Spend more time in JavaScript or Python? Your personal dashboard shows the metrics you care about.

Compete with your friends on private leaderboards, improve your daily coding average, and check your rank against other WakaTime users.

Install the plugin

  1. Install wakatime-cli:

    curl -fsSL https://raw.githubusercontent.com/wakatime/vim-wakatime/master/scripts/install_cli.py | python

    If the above command doesn't work, download install_cli.py and run it manually with Python 3.

  2. Create a ~/.wakatime.cfg file with contents:

    [settings] api_key = XXXX

    Replace XXXX with your actual API Key.

  3. Put wakatime.kak in your autoload folder, located at $XDG_CONFIG_HOME/kak/autoload.

    (Usually ~/.config/kak/autoload or /usr/local/share/kak/autoload)

  4. Use Kakoune like normal and your stats will automatically show on your WakaTime Dashboard.

For information about the ~/.wakatime.cfg format, see the wakatime-cli docs.